    This week at school, we worked in groups to do research on oceans. Some of us studied the Atlantic while others learned about the Pacific, the Indian and the Arctic Oceans. We used the iPads to find information. When we were done, we presented our ocean to the class. 
        Mr. McKiel came to visit us and taught us about polar bears. He went to Churchill a few years ago and got up close to polar bears. We made a list of questions for him and he answered most of them. Maggie learned that a polar bear's paw is about the size of a dinner plate. Nate learned that they can live in the wild for 20 years and that the dad lives by himself. Gerri found out that polar bears are furry but dangerous. We will learn more about them next week.
